There are two main types of voting systems that can lead to different party systems. These are “first past the post” or “winner take all” systems on the one hand and proportional representation systems on the other. Each of these will tend to lead to a different type of party system.
<span>Each state has representatives in the House, the number of representatives each state receives is determined by the population of each state. Every state has at least one representative, but the higher the population, the more representatives each state receives in the house to represent their state. Currently there are 435 representatives in the house, this number has been fixed by lay since 1911.</span>
